The machine performs selective wave soldering, an advanced method for through-hole components using programmable flux spraying, preheating, and welding modules.
It is ideal for high-reliability sectors like military, aerospace, railway, automotive electronics, and switching power supplies.
Automatic tinning supports 2mm diameter tin wire and accommodates 1kg to 4kg coils with adjustable frequency and timing.
Automatic cleaning uses a powder method with customizable locations, frequency, and duration to prevent nozzle oxidation.
Fiducial identification and positioning employ a high-definition camera system with multiple image recognition modes.
The system allows selectable activation of recognition functions for precise component alignment.
It ensures reliable welding through controlled preheating and point-by-point soldering processes.
